Abstract
An all-solid-state surfactant sensitive electrode has been prepared, based on a teflonised graphite conducting substrate coated with plasticised PVC-membrane containing a new synthesized tetrahexadecylammonium-dodecylsulfate as anionic surfactant sensing material. The electrode exhibited Nernstian response (58.1 mV/decade) for dodecylbenzensulfonate and a near-Nernstian response (64.2 mV/decade) for dodecylsulfate. The electrode was used as end-point indicatior for potentiometric surfactant titrations. The selectivity coefficients relating to the common inorganic and organic anions have been calculated by modelling of Nikolskii–Eisenman equation. Several commercial surfactants have been also titrated. The electrode enables the titration of shorter hydrocarbon chain anionic surfactants, as well.
